security login motd show

Contributors
Suggest changes

Display the message of the day

Availability: This command is available to cluster and Vserver administrators at the admin privilege level.

Description

The security login motd show command displays information about the cluster-level and data Vserver clustershell message of the day (MOTD).

Parameters

{ [-fields <fieldname>,…​]

If you specify the -fields <fieldname>, …​ parameter, the command output also includes the specified field or fields. You can use '-fields ?' to display the fields to specify.

| [-instance ] }

If you specify the -instance parameter, the command displays detailed information about all fields.

[-vserver <Vserver Name>] - Vserver Name

Selects the message of the day entries that match this parameter value. Use the name of the cluster admin Vserver to see the cluster-level MOTD.

[-message <text>] - Message of the Day (MOTD)

Selects the message of the day entries that match this parameter value.

[-is-cluster-message-enabled {true|false}] - Is Cluster-level Message Enabled?

Selects the message of the day entries that match this parameter value.

Examples

The following example displays all message of the day entries:

cluster1::> security login motd show
Vserver: cluster1
Is the Cluster MOTD Displayed?: true
Message
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
The cluster is running normally.

Vserver: vs0
Is the Cluster MOTD Displayed?: true
Message
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
Welcome to the Vserver!

2 entries were displayed.
